DeSantis Vows to Ban Teaching Critical Race Theory: It’s “Offensive” to Have Taxpayers Fund Education on “Hating the State”

The Breitbart News reported on May 22 that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is (R) vowed to take action against critical race theory promoted by the left in a speech Friday. DeSantis pointed out that the divisive, race-focused approach to teaching requires spending taxpayer dollars on a curriculum that “teaches kids to hate their country and hate their peers,” which is actually “offensive. His speech drew a round of applause from the audience.

Speaking to reporters in Pensacola on Friday, DeSantis said he strongly opposed critical race theory and vowed it would not be embraced in the Sunshine State. DeSantis said, “The Florida State Board of Education is meeting and they’re dealing with this issue. “

“Critical Race Theory, or CRT for short, looks at everything through the lens of “race” and skin color. The goal of CRT is not really to fight racism, but to create division and hatred.

The Republican governor also highlighted the fundamental flaws of critical race theory, explaining that it is based on a “false history. He explained, “When they try to look back and denigrate the Founding Fathers and denigrate the American Revolution, very liberal historians have said that they have no facts to back that up. “

DeSantis said, “The Constitution needs to be brought back into the classroom. Civic education needs to be taught accurately, on the basis of facts, not indoctrinated according to ideology. We’re going to stop this critical race theory in Florida. We’re going to take action, and you don’t have to worry. “The governor’s speech again sparked applause.

Florida is not the only state taking action against critical race theory. This week, Republicans in the Utah House and Senate, passed resolutions opposing the advancement of critical race theory in schools.
